Maxis is looking for a Web Designer to support our efforts at reimagining our internal website / information hub. This person will work with multiple teams across the Maxis studio to understand, design, plan, track, and implement our internal website / information hub projects. A typical day will include conversations with project or business leaders, documentation and creative assets gathering, website architecture/content page framework building, and maintaining timeline and deliverables to ensure on time project completion

This person will report to the Director of Business Operations, Maxis.

Responsibilities:

  • You will produce visual elements (concepts, mocks, sample pages & prototypes) consistent with studio brand and voice
  • You will design the structure and implement an internal website/information hub for Maxis
  • You will maintain regular communications within project partners and stakeholders
  • You will maintain and report on roadmap status across the project(s)
  • You will anticipate and escalate communications regarding risks, problems and roadblocks
  • You will facilitate regular checkpoints with partners to maintain alignment and balanced solutions that adhere to users and business goals

Qualifications:

  • Experienced in web design, information architecture and web programming languages such as HTML, CSS, JavaScript.
  • Experience using modern CMSs. 
  • Ability to translate project thoughts and specifications into an appealing design, and turning a design into a functional site
  • Proficiency in Adobe Creative Suite, including Photoshop, Illustrator, After Effects
  • Proficiency in modern prototyping tools: Figma, Sketch, Adobe XD etc.
  • Ability to communicate (written and verbal) with a broad range of audiences in a constructive manner
  • Capable of coordinating different tasks in parallel
  • You are adaptable in both communication and information gathering to achieve results in a quick-changing, dynamic environment
  • Project management experience using the Google Suite and Miro
  • You are comfortable presenting and rationalizing design strategy and decisions to diverse audiences
